What Our Customers Say About T...
Travelbug Baby Equipment Rentals not only has the best customers, but we love what we do. Our reputation for excellent service mean…
Travelbug Baby Equipment Rentals not only has the best customers, but we love what we do. Our reputation for excellent service mean…